A Day in the Life

At our HR Shared Services we operationalize, execute & consult on Global Talent & Leadership Development (GTLD) programs and processes to ensure a valuable and personalized HR experience for both employees and managers. The team focuses on building a trusted partnership, showcasing efficiencies, and solving problems to improve outcomes and enable the business. The job opening is for a contingent role. The Associate will collaborate with Medtronic COE, facilitators and learning vendors on a global as well as EurAsia scale (EMEA, APAC).

Responsibilities may include the following and other duties may be assigned:

  • Partner across HR functions to establish and maintain operational standards and procedures that ensure accurate transactions and effective program delivery
  • Provide system, program, and project support for initiatives such as High Performing Teams, SkillsLab, and Organizational Health
  • Support financial processes related to Global Talent programs, including documentation of key deliverables and budget-related actions
  • Contribute to system requirements that enhance efficiency, automation, and self-service capabilities
  • Identify and resolve customer-impacting issues, driving process improvements and standardization
  • Participate in cross-functional workstreams focused on enhancing employee experience.

Required Knowledge and Experience:

  • Minimum 2 years of experience in HR Shared Services or a similar operational HR role 
  • Fluent in English (written and spoken) 
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office and experienced with at least two HR systems (e.g., Cornerstone, Outlook, ServiceNow) 
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ills 
  • Collaborative and proactive team player.
